suraj Posted December 3, 2008 Posted December 3, 2008 JAJPUR: A woman in Jajpur was allegedly paraded naked and beaten up mercilessly by villagers after her son eloped with a girl from the same locality. The incident took place at Binjharpur — the constituency of Orissa's women and child welfare minister Pramila Mallick. Shantilata Khandual of Bangara village in Binjharpur was forced to move court after police allegedly refused to register a case. In her complaint, the 45-year-old woman alleged that police forced her to compromise with her attackers instead of taking action against them. The incident has not only exposed the callousness of police but also put the entire police department in a spot. Sources said the elder son of the woman eloped with a girl on November 24. The same day, some villagers attacked her when she pleaded ignorance about the whereabouts of her son and the girl. "They dragged me out of my house. Though I was screaming in pain none came to my rescue. I was paraded naked after they tied my hands and legs. One of them even urinated on my mouth. They left me only after I fell unconscious,'' she alleged. Shantilata said her experience at the police station was more traumatic. "Police asked me to compromise with my attackers when I went to the police station to lodge a complaint.
